About SIMPLEEX AUTO TRADES

Company Overview

SIMPLEEX AUTO TRADES is a trading platform registered in the United States and founded on 30 October 2025. The company operates through the domain simpleexautotrade.com and presents itself as an artificial intelligence-driven trading service. It targets retail investors seeking automated trading solutions.

According to public records, the broker has no known regulatory licences from any financial authority. Traders should be aware that the absence of regulation means operations are not overseen by any government or independent body, which carries inherent counterparty risk.

Account Types and Minimum Deposits

The broker offers four account tiers: Diamond, Gold, Silver, and Bronze. Minimum deposit requirements range from $300 for the Bronze account up to $15,000 for the Diamond account. Leverage information is not specified for any tier.

The tiered structure suggests that higher deposit accounts may receive additional features or services, though the broker does not detail these on its public materials. Investors should consider the substantial minimum deposits, particularly for the higher tiers.

Platform and Instruments

The broker's website claims to provide a 'global platform' for trading, but does not list any specific financial instruments such as forex pairs, indices, commodities, or cryptocurrencies. It is unclear whether the platform offers CFDs, spot trading, or other asset classes.

The website emphasises AI technology and passive earning, but technical details about the trading platform (e.g., MetaTrader, web-based, proprietary) are not disclosed. This lack of transparency makes it difficult for traders to evaluate the actual trading environment.

Target Audience

SIMPLEEX AUTO TRADES appears to be aimed at retail traders and investors interested in automated, AI-driven strategies. The marketing language emphasises passive income and risk-free solutions, which may appeal to novice traders seeking short-term gains.

However, the high minimum deposits for Gold and Diamond accounts ($12,000 and $15,000) suggest the broker may be targeting wealthier individuals. Without regulatory safeguards, such investors face elevated risk.

Conclusion

SIMPLEEX AUTO TRADES is a newly established, unregulated trading platform with limited public information. The absence of regulatory oversight, combined with vague descriptions of its trading offerings and high deposit thresholds, presents a cautious picture for potential users.

As with any unregulated broker, traders should conduct thorough due diligence and consider the risks before committing funds. The broker's reliance on AI technology and promises of stable returns should be critically evaluated.
